How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Greenbelt?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Greenbelt Studio Apartments | $1,718 | $1,052 | $2,210 |
| Greenbelt 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,091 | $1,050 | $9,999 |
| Greenbelt 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,194 | $850 | $3,818 |
| Greenbelt 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,487 | $1,059 | $4,530 |
| Greenbelt 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,390 | $859 | $2,953 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om Greenbelt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Greenbelt with 3 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 3 Bedroom in Greenbelt is at New Carrollton Woods listed at $1,830.
How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om Greenbelt Apartment?
The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in Greenbelt is $2,487.
What is the largest available 3 Bedroom Greenbelt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Greenbelt is a 1,500 square feet unit starting from $3,961 at Aster.
What is the average size for Greenbelt 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in Greenbelt is currently 1,718 sq ft.
